Looking at the ephemeris, Mercury went direct today (4th Dec) and

Mars goes direct on 10th December.

 

What is the real impact of Mars retrograde in ones chart. Does it

negatively (or positively if Mars is Dustanan Houses or vakra in

Rasi chart) effect the area of the chart according to dashas and

transits.

 

Mars is also related to surgery, so can we deduce that under Mars

retro, one should not have an operation, or only be cautious of

operations when Mars is in 6th.

 

I know Western Astrologers go crazy about Mercury Retrograde

affecting communication and computers – has anyone experienced

this. I have been tracking Merc Retro with curiosity, but although

there were the odd communication related events, but couldn't

specifically attribute it to vakra Mercury. My confusion is how can

a planet affect anything exclusively, surely it's a combination of

dasha, planetary positions and transits confirming. Transiting

planets do cast an influence on everyone, so the malfunctioning of a

laptop should be attributed to the dasha and placement of the

planets in the chart of Manufacture of the Laptop, as opposed to the

User of the laptop. Hope Im not getting myself in a loop here

 

Could you please refer me to any Jyotish material on retrogade

planets and how to interpret its effects

 

This may be a beginner's question and may seem obvious, but have

posted it so that other beginners can learn from this too

Dear Bipin

 

Mercury retrograde affects many people irrespective of their dasa or

trasits in some way or the other.

 

Now whatever mercury lords in the horoscope that issue always is

bound be affected when mercury goes retro.

 

Mercury in general rules communication, and thus affects

communication for many. It is better to have mouna vrata during

mercury retro periods. Meditation is best
